ꦧꦺꦴꦛꦺꦴꦏ꧀
Javanese
Etymology
Inherited from Old Javanese boṭok.
Pronunciation
- IPA(key): /bɔʈɔk/
- Rhymes: -ʈɔk
- Hyphenation: bo‧thok
Noun
ꦧꦺꦴꦛꦺꦴꦏ꧀ (bothok)
- (cooking) traditional Javanese dish made from grated coconut flesh which has been squeezed of its coconut milk, often mixed with other ingredients such as vegetables or fish, and wrapped in banana leaf and steamed
Derived terms
- ꦩ꧀ꦧꦺꦴꦛꦺꦴꦏ꧀ (mbothok)
Descendants
- → Indonesian: botok
